Partitioning

Oracle 11g,將刪除分區重用大文件表空間上的可用空間

  • January 29, 2019

我有四個屬於大文件表空間的範圍分區表。該表上的本地索引也屬於其他大文件表空間。我的分區範圍是一天,我有一個儲存過程,可以從每個表中刪除超過 30 天的分區。至於現在(從開始收集數據開始的 15 天),我的數據文件(數據和索引)按預期穩步增長。我的問題是,當儲存過程刪除超過 30 天的第一個分區時,該空間是否可用於新分區或數據文件將繼續增長?

它將可用。根據您的空間管理設置,它幾乎可以將新分區完全放入空間中,或者可能存在一些間隙,但大部分空間將被重複使用。

我不希望增長會在 30 天后立即停止,具體取決於碎片,但它最終會停止。使用統一的擴展或至少一個大的最小尺寸來擴展會有所幫助,特別是如果您期望大分區。

使用 LOB 時,保留也可能會發揮作用。

引用自:https://dba.stackexchange.com/questions/228325